Description

2-(2-Bromoisobutyryloxy)Ethyl Methacrylate is a specialized bifunctional monomer featuring both a polymerizable methacrylate group and an atom transfer radical polymerization (ATRP) initiator moiety. This compound matters as a critical building block for synthesizing well-defined polymers with complex architectures, such as block copolymers, star polymers, and polymer brushes. It is essential for researchers and manufacturers in advanced materials science, particularly those developing functional coatings, thermoplastic elastomers, drug delivery systems, and surface-modified nanoparticles.

Application

  • ATRP Macroinitiator: Primary use as a versatile initiator for grafting polymers from surfaces or other polymer backbones via Atom Transfer Radical Polymerization.
  • Block Copolymer Synthesis: Key monomer for creating precisely controlled block copolymers with tailored properties for adhesives, compatibilizers, and nanostructured materials.
  • Surface Modification: Used to create polymer brushes on silicon, gold, or polymer substrates to alter surface characteristics like wettability, friction, and biocompatibility.
  • Functional Hydrogels & Networks: Incorporated into cross-linked networks to introduce degradable or responsive units for biomedical and sensor applications.
  • Advanced Coatings: Enables the synthesis of coatings with specific mechanical, chemical, or anti-fouling properties.
  • Nanoparticle Functionalization: Facilitates the controlled growth of polymer shells on nanoparticles for stabilization and targeted functionality.
  • Telechelic Polymers: Serves as an inimer (initiator-monomer) for preparing α-functionalized polymers with reactive end-groups.

Basic Information

Product Name 2-(2-Bromoisobutyryloxy)Ethyl Methacrylate
CAS No. 213453-08-8
Molecular Formula C11H17BrO4
Molecular Weight 293.16 g/mol
Synonyms 2-(2-Bromo-2-methylpropanoyloxy)ethyl methacrylate; 2-Methacryloyloxyethyl 2-bromo-2-methylpropionate; BiBEM; 2-(2-Bromoisobutyryloxy)ethyl 2-methylacrylate; Ethylene glycol methacrylate 2-bromoisobutyrate; ATRP Initiator Ester Monomer; 2-Hydroxyethyl methacrylate 2-bromoisobutyrate ester; 2-Bromo-2-methylpropionic acid 2-(methacryloyloxy)ethyl ester

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at temperatures between 2°C and 8°C (refrigerated) to maintain stability and inhibit premature polymerization. The product is light-sensitive (store away from light) and should be handled in a compatible environment away from strong acids and organic solvents. Allow the container to reach ambient temperature before opening to prevent moisture condensation.
